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Numerous HVAC problems require emergency service. Acknowledging these issues can assist you understand when to require expert help: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working completely, especially throughout severe weather condition, it's more than simply an hassle-- it can be dangerous. Our emergency HVAC professionals can diagnose and repair the problem promptly,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Weird seem like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system frequently signify a major mechanical problem that might lead to larger issues if not addressed rapidly. Similarly, unusual smells might indicate electrical problems or perhaps gas leakages. Our professional HVAC professionals can recognize these problems and make necessary repair work before they become dangerous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water leaking from your HVAC system can harm your home and lead to mold development. Our professionals locate the source of leaks and fix them appropriately to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ks lower your air conditioning unit's cooling capacity and can damage the environment. They need professional attention as refrigerant dealing with calls for spec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ical elements in your HVAC system pose fire dangers and need to be addressed right away by certified experts. Our HVAC professionals have the training to securely fix electrical problems.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ted air flow makes your system work more difficult and lowers convenience. Our HVAC contractors determine airflow issues, whether caused by duct issues, dirty filters, or fan issues.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ation problems, or an incorrectly sized system. Our professional HVAC contractors can identify these issues and suggest solutions.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system turns on and off frequently, it loses energy and breaks components much faster. Our HVAC professionals can figure out whether the issue stems from a clogged up fil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Abrupt boosts in energy bills often indicate HVAC ineffectiveness. Our specialists carry out energy efficiency evaluations to recognize the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ems need to help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summertime or too dry in winter, our HVAC specialists can recommend options to enhance conv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    In some cases what seems like a system failure is actually a thermostat problem. Our HVAC specialists can repair or replace thermostats and help you upgrade to programmable or smart models for better comfort control and energy cost savings.
